package com.google.gwt.inject.client;
import java.lang.annotation.ElementType;
import java.lang.annotation.Retention;
import java.lang.annotation.RetentionPolicy;
import java.lang.annotation.Target;
/**
* An annotation to put on {@code @Ginjector} subtypes to indicate which
* {@code GinModule} implementations to use. List the {@link GinModule} classes
* using the {@code value} parameter. If you wish to specify gin module classes
* from a GWT module file, list the name of the configuration properties as
* string using the {@code properties} parameter.
*
* Example:
*
@GinModules(value=MyGinModule.class, properties="example.ginModules")
* public interface ConfigurationModulesGinjector extends Ginjector {
* // ...
* }
*
* In MyApp.gwt.xml:
* <define-configuration-property name="example.ginModules" is-multi-valued="true" />
* <extend-configuration-property name="example.ginModules"
* value="com.company.myapp.client.ExampleModule1" />
* <extend-configuration-property name="example.ginModules"
* value="com.company.myapp.client.ExampleModule2" />
*/
@Retention(RetentionPolicy.RUNTIME)
@Target({ElementType.TYPE})
public @interface GinModules {
Class extends GinModule>[] value();
String[] properties() default {};
}
